Anything up to 250% of the transformer primary full load amps. However ratings less than 125% may result in breaker tripping on energization from the inrush current.
 
See table 450.3(B). For size of primary you have to weigh the increased cost of the device and conductors to go big versus the chance of tripping on energization if you go smaller. Secondary isn't really a concern because you will have a CPD there anyway to comply with 240.21 and possibly 408.36.
